• Home
  • Química
  • Astronomia
  • Energia
  • Natureza
  • Biologia
  • Física
  • Eletrônicos
  • Protegendo o direito de ser esquecido na era do blockchain
    p Uma nova estrutura oferece controle administrativo total de seus dados armazenados em blockchain. Crédito:Shutterstock

    p Houve muito entusiasmo sobre o blockchain no ano passado. Embora mais conhecida como a tecnologia que sustenta o Bitcoin, blockchain está começando a perturbar outras indústrias, das cadeias de abastecimento ao comércio de energia. p Um dos principais pontos de venda do blockchain é que, uma vez que os dados são adicionados à cadeia, não pode ser alterado ou removido. Isso torna o blockchain confiável.

    p Mas essa mesma imutabilidade torna o blockchain problemático em um mundo onde as leis de privacidade exigem que as empresas excluam seus dados de bancos de dados uma vez que tenham servido ao seu propósito. Isso é conhecido em algumas jurisdições como o "direito ao esquecimento".

    p Projetamos um blockchain no qual os usuários podem remover seus dados do banco de dados sem violar a consistência do blockchain.

    p Atualmente, há um mercado crescente de dispositivos da Internet das Coisas, de casas inteligentes e carros autônomos a assistentes de voz e medidores de energia inteligentes. Esses dispositivos coletam continuamente biografias digitais de nossas vidas. Como esses dados estão cada vez mais sendo armazenados em blockchains, a tensão entre a blockchain e o direito de ser esquecido só vai aumentar. Nossa ferramenta pode ajudar.

    p Como funciona o blockchain

    p Em seu núcleo, blockchain é um banco de dados gerenciado em conjunto por um conjunto distribuído de participantes. Sempre que novos dados são adicionados ao banco de dados, todos os participantes devem concordar em verificá-lo. Desta maneira, o blockchain elimina a necessidade de um terceiro, como um banco, para verificar as transações.

    p O livro razão do blockchain é organizado em blocos, onde cada bloco está vinculado ao bloco anterior por meio de funções de hash criptográficas. Essas funções criam um código curto com base no conteúdo do bloco anterior, e não é possível adivinhar este código sem tentar todos os códigos possíveis. O encadeamento dos blocos desta maneira garante que os dados armazenados neles não possam ser alterados, pois qualquer alteração feita quebraria a consistência do blockchain.

    p Isso torna os blockchains imutáveis. Também torna os dados do blockchain fáceis de rastrear e auditar, particularmente para grandes redes como a Internet das Coisas. Esses recursos são altamente atraentes para organizações que operam além das fronteiras organizacionais, e em ambientes onde os participantes podem não confiar totalmente uns nos outros.

    p Desafios regulatórios

    p O recente Regulamento Geral de Proteção de Dados (GDPR) da União Europeia é uma parte significativa da legislação que está em desacordo com uma economia digital sustentada por blockchain.

    p O GDPR exige que as empresas que mantêm os dados das pessoas apaguem esses dados quando o propósito original para o qual eles precisavam for concluído. Isso significa que as pessoas devem ser capazes de remover seus dados de bancos de dados de terceiros após um determinado período de tempo.

    p Blockchain - sendo imutável - apresenta um obstáculo para o exercício desse direito.

    p Riscos para a privacidade

    p Digamos que você more em uma casa inteligente que usa dados de sensores para monitorar a segurança de sua casa. Você tem uma apólice de seguro residencial e, para receber prêmios mais baixos, você permite que seus dados de alarme de fumaça e sensor de segurança sejam registrados em um blockchain.

    p Os dados do blockchain podem ser acessados ​​pela polícia, o corpo de bombeiros e a seguradora para que possam auditar qualquer alarme de fumaça ou eventos de segurança. Assim que o seu período de seguro terminar, você deve ser capaz de remover seus dados de segurança do blockchain para aumentar sua privacidade.

    p Se você deixou seus dados no blockchain indefinidamente, isso aumentaria o risco de seus dados serem identificados como seus, e suas atividades sendo rastreadas por qualquer entidade com acesso ao blockchain.

    p Um participante do blockchain normalmente usa uma ou mais chaves públicas como suas identidades. As transações em blockchain são armazenadas anonimamente, já que não há ligação direta entre as chaves públicas e a identidade real do participante. Mas uma violação de identidade em qualquer uma das transações, por exemplo, vinculando o conteúdo da transação a outros dados conhecidos sobre o usuário, leva a todas as interações dos dispositivos dos usuários, armazenado em blockchain, a ser rastreado por todos os participantes do blockchain.

    p Remover dados sem quebrar a corrente

    p Portanto, poder remover dados do blockchain sem "quebrar a cadeia" seria benéfico para a privacidade do usuário. Também seria benéfico economizar espaço de armazenamento nos servidores que armazenam os livros razão do blockchain.

    p Mas atualmente, remover dados de um blockchain não é possível sem quebrar a consistência do blockchain.

    p Nós criamos uma solução que torna possível remover seus dados detalhados de transações de um banco de dados blockchain, sem remover o rastreio auditável de que a transação ocorreu.

    p Conforme descrito em nossa publicação revisada por pares deste mês, Blockchain flexível com otimização de memória permite que você armazene temporariamente, resumir, ou remova completamente suas transações do blockchain, enquanto mantém a consistência do blockchain.

    p O rastreamento restante dos dados (seu hash) no blockchain ainda pode ser usado no futuro, no caso de surgirem disputas sobre o que aconteceu. Por exemplo, se o proprietário de uma casa quisesse verificar se ocorreu um assalto em sua casa ao abrigo de uma apólice de seguro anterior, eles podem fornecer uma cópia privada dos dados com seu hash associado. Uma autoridade legal poderia então comparar o hash dos dados da pessoa com o hash que ainda está armazenado no blockchain compartilhado e, assim, validar a autenticidade da reivindicação da pessoa.

    p Essa abordagem fornece controle administrativo total de seus dados armazenados em blockchain. Torna possível para você remover ou resumir esses dados, sem sacrificar a capacidade de auditar os dados no futuro.

    p Recuperando privacidade e controle

    p É importante observar que nossa abordagem publicada pode ser executada sobre qualquer solução de blockchain existente, e não afeta a consistência do blockchain. Os links entre os blocos por meio de funções hash são preservados, mesmo quando blocos específicos são removidos ou resumidos da cadeia. Em outras palavras, o link de qualquer entrada do blockchain permanece, mas o saco que contém alguns dados pode ser solto.

    p Na verdade, contanto que o conteúdo removido seja armazenado de forma privada fora do blockchain, a autenticidade dos dados pode ser verificada independentemente em um momento posterior, comparando-os com o hash no blockchain. Desta maneira, você pode recuperar o controle de quaisquer dados compartilhados anteriormente e exercer seu direito de ser esquecido na era do blockchain. p Este artigo foi republicado de The Conversation sob uma licença Creative Commons. Leia o artigo original.




    © Ciência https://pt.scienceaq.com